I've seen a lot of discourse surrounding OPLA Sanji talking about Sora. Full disclosure, I have not seen the latest season of OPLA, but I did watch the first. Too many moments that endeared me to the characters, had been changed in a way that I felt missed the initial intent of them, and put me off watching further seasons.
Any way, this is a vent of sorts. I just wanted a place to collect my thoughts on it. If you enjoyed the scene, that is fine. You are welcome to enjoy the change. That being said, this post may not be for you.
So, again I have not watched the 2nd season. It might make sense in the show why things played out the way it did. When thinking about how things happened in the anime/manga, it would make more sense for Usopp to be handling Nami's sickness poorly. As a reader/watcher, we are already aware that Usopp lost his mother through sickness. Nami and Usopp have a great bond in the animaga, so it could have been a sweet way in the LA to sort of develop it more.
It's only with hindsight that you could theories, that Sanji kept watch in the crowsnest, as he was unable to sleep from worry. Maybe he was so adamant to travel with Luffy up the mountain, as he wanted to be able to do something to help, when he wasn't able to with Sora. This is only speculation though, as it was not hinted to be the case in the original source.
I know there is a chance that Oda did not plan Sanji's second backstory that far back, but I'm also sceptical of that. Mainly as his first story started with Sanji being 10 years old on a cruise ship. There was no mention of him losing his parents in the storm. There is also this SBS that came out around Arlong Park.
This could be a joke from Oda as a lot of the SBS answers tend to be jokes. That being said, it could have been foreshadowing that there is more to Sanji, than we initially thought. So I agree that Oda did not fully plan Sanji's backstory; Sanji was only a quad due to Oda's daughter (I still think Sanji was always meant to be the 3rd kid, due to his name) but I think Oda planned some of it.
Now why Sanji telling Nami would not be in character for OG Sanji. Even though Sanji is emotional, he is not vulnerable in front of the crew. If he does have a vulnerable moment, he is pretty much corned into it, or he is with Luffy. Only Luffy has seen him cry at the Baratie and in WCI. Nami did find Sanji at Enis Lobby, but I don't remember him crying in the manga. He was definitely fustrated at himself, but not sad. I suppose Sanji telling Zoro to get a new cook in Thriller Bark and asking Zoro to kill him in Wano, could be considered as vulnerable. Actually, now that I think about it, Sanji admitting that his body was acting strange, could be a sign of vulnerability. Also Sanji asking Robin for help. These last 3 examples are after WCI, when begins to start healing after everything that happened to him.
Sanji is pretty traumatised after growing up in Germa. He was beaten for showing emotions. When Sora died, Sanji was thrown into the dungeon for 6 months forced to wear an iron mask, when he cried at her grave. When Sanji ran into Judge after trying to escape, Judge told Sanji to never speak about where he is from. It's not too far of a leap to come to the conclusions that Sanji would be too scared, or at least hesitant, to talk about Germa and, by extention, his mother. (Even if it is subconsciously) This is the guy that was told by Zeff that he would pretty much disown Sanji if he ever hit woman, so would rather die than kick a woman. Sanji sort of takes rules to the extreme. Sanji is extreme and needs therapy.
OG Sanji never mentions Sora to anyone in the crew, during or after WCI. The only person he talks about his mother to, is Reiju. I can't remember who brought Sora up.
I get people's point that the LA may never reach WCI, so what's the harm in showing things early. I don't really agree with it, as it spoils things for people who decide to pick up the animanga after. (Like Garp existence in the LA. Which is something that ODA did not agree to. People seem to think Oda has power over everything in the LA, but he probably has the same level of involvement as he does in most of the OP movies, which is not much at all) That being said, there were other ways Sanji's second backstory could had been hinted to. Did you know that Usopp's goggles are from the North Blue?
There could have been a line where Sanji states he recognises the design. When Usopp states that they are from the Navy in the North Blue, Sanji can cover his slip up by saying he probably saw a customer at the Baratie with them. Y'know, hint at Sanji's past, without doing anything too OOC.
So. Yeah. There are my thoughts, thown out into the void. If you have gotten this far, thank you for taking the time to humor my rambles.
